hi, well i got the speaker stands today, put the speakers on them and they fitted great,,,,,then i tried to take them of and the speaker was well and truly stuck, i ended up turning the speaker upside down and twisting the pole of, has any one got any tips on making things a bit easier to get the pole of the speaker?

Seriously though... check the "hole" on the speaker for any flashing (bits of plastic from where it was molded)
If it is plastic and you can feel a few bits of rough, then some sandpaper etc may take it off.
If the hole is smooth on the inside, dunno!

They will get easier to pull off after a bit of use. In the meantime, a little vaseline works wonders.

if there is a cap at the top of the pole you will often find that is bigger than the pole width - soon as you loose that or it gets stuck in the speaker the pole will slide more easily :-)
